What is Load Balancing?
Load balancing is a technique that ensures an organization's server does not get overloaded with traffic. With load balancing measures in place, workloads and traffic requests are distributed across server resources to provide higher resilience and availability.

What is Server Management?
Most IT functions depend on the health and infrastructure of servers, making proper server management an essential task for data center administrators. Server management is a complex process, especially with the growth of cloud computing. System administrators must be able to continuously manage physical server hardware, virtual machines and a variety of application and database servers simultaneously.
